OPA2277UA

OPA2277UA

Overview

Category: Operational Amplifier
Use: Signal amplification and conditioning
Characteristics: High precision, low noise, low offset voltage
Package: SOIC-8
Essence: Dual operational amplifier
Packaging/Quantity: Tube of 50 units

Specifications

  • Supply Voltage Range: ±2.25V to ±18V
  • Input Offset Voltage: 150µV (maximum)
  • Input Bias Current: 1nA (maximum)
  • Input Noise Voltage: 10nV/√Hz (typical)
  • Gain Bandwidth Product: 8MHz (typical)
  • Slew Rate: 4V/µs (typical)
  • Output Current: 40mA (maximum)

Working Principles

The OPA2277UA is based on a differential input stage followed by a gain stage. The input stage provides high input impedance and low input offset voltage, while the gain stage amplifies the differential signal. The output stage is capable of driving capacitive loads with low distortion.
